Size of the Dumpster Matters


Selecting a Roll Off Dumpster: Size of the Dumpster Matters


Normally, homeowners and contractors require dumpsters varying in size from 10 to 40 cubic backyards, depending on the level and nature of their projects. Selecting the correct size dumpster is crucial to guarantee reliable waste management and prevent extra costs.


Weight constraints play a significant function in figuring out the perfect dumpster size. For example, a 10-cubic-yard dumpster might be proper for small-scale restorations, but it may not be appropriate for bigger projects that produce heavier particles.


Placement logistics also enter play, as bigger dumpsters may need more space and accessibility for delivery and pickup. It'' s important to take into account the offered area on-site and the dumpster'' s measurements to make sure a smooth operation.

Can I Put Contaminated Materials in a Roll-Off Dumpster?


When it concerns disposing of hazardous waste, it'' s important to understand that roll-off dumpsters are not a suitable solution.


Ecological regulations strictly restrict the disposal of dangerous materials, such as batteries, electronic devices, and chemicals, in landfills. Correct disposal of these products requires specialized centers and managing to prevent environmental damage.


It'' s crucial to explore alternative, environment-friendly options for hazardous waste disposal to ensure compliance with regulations and protect our environment.


Do I Need an Authorization to Position a Dumpster on My Property?


When placing a dumpster on your property, it'' s important to determine if a license is required. Permit requirements differ by jurisdiction, so it'' s essential to check with your local government for specific guidelines.


Home policies, such as homeowners' ' association rules or local ordinances, may likewise apply. Stopping working to get the needed permits can lead to fines or removal of the dumpster.


Research study and adhere to regional regulations to ensure a smooth and hassle-free dumpster rental experience.
